China Packaged Rice Snacks Market Size 2026-2030
The china packaged rice snacks market size is valued to increase by USD 530 million, at a CAGR of 6.9% from 2025 to 2030. Shift toward health-conscious consumption and gluten-free alternatives will drive the china packaged rice snacks market.

By Distribution Channel Insights
The offline segment is estimated to witness significant growth during the forecast period.
The offline segment remains foundational to the packaged rice snacks market in China, where physical retail allows for crucial brand visibility and impulse purchases.
Hypermarkets and supermarkets facilitate broad consumer access, while the expansion of community-based convenience stores brings premium and artisan rice cracker options closer to residential areas.
This channel is heavily influenced by the health-conscious snacking trend, with approximately 77% of consumers viewing plant-based snacks as vital for healthy aging, a sentiment that directly shapes in-store promotions and product placement.
Success in this space requires a sophisticated omnichannel retail logistics strategy and effective social commerce marketing to drive foot traffic.
Manufacturers must also navigate food safety compliance and maintain a resilient supply chain traceability system to meet the rigorous standards of modern brick-and-mortar partners.
The Offline segment was valued at USD 1.01 billion in 2024 and showed a gradual increase during the forecast period.

What challenges does the China Packaged Rice Snacks Industry face during its growth?
- A key challenge impacting industry growth is the intense competitive pressure from a diverse and expanding range of alternative snack categories.
- The market faces significant hurdles, primarily from intense competition and operational volatility. The competitive snack category, particularly from potato-based products, leverages aggressive flavor innovation cycles that can erode market share by up to 10% annually if not countered. This requires a robust private label snack development strategy and constant value-added snack formulation.
- A primary operational issue is raw material cost fluctuation, which can impact gross margins by as much as 18% in a single quarter. Navigating this requires sophisticated sourcing and inventory management. Furthermore, stringent food safety compliance and end-to-end traceability mandates, while essential, add significant overhead, increasing operational costs for manufacturers by an average of 8% without immediate ROI.

Recent Development and News in China packaged rice snacks market
- In May, 2025, Three Squirrels Inc. launched a new line of functional rice crisps featuring plant-based proteins and probiotics, marketed through a targeted social commerce campaign aimed at health-conscious urban consumers.
- In March, 2025, a leading private equity firm acquired a significant minority stake in Element Snacks Inc., indicating strong investor confidence in the premium and organic rice snack category.
- In January, 2025, Kameda Seika Co. Ltd. announced a strategic collaboration with a major quick-commerce platform to ensure 30-minute delivery for its rice cracker products across key tier-1 cities in China.
- In November, 2024, Want Want China Holdings Ltd. announced the completion of an upgrade to its primary manufacturing facility, integrating an AI-driven digital twin system that improved production efficiency and reduced material waste by 15%.
